## Formula sandbox tuning

User-supplied formulas in Gridmoor execute inside a restricted interpreter with hard ceilings on time, memory, and call depth. Reviewers should confirm any change to these ceilings is justified in the PR description, since raising them widens the abuse surface. Defaults were chosen from production traces. The current limits are as follows.

limits module of tafog-fawip:
WEIGHTS = {
    "julix": 57,
    "lamys": 992,
    "kasvan": 209,
    "quenok": 750,
    "alddor": 259,
    "oliath": 1009,
    "wenix": 815,
}

Handover note — Crumbwheel order cutoffs.

Welcome aboard. The bakery cutoff rule in Crumbwheel closes same-day orders at 14:00 local to each storefront, not UTC — this has bitten us twice. Holiday overrides live in the calendar service and take precedence silently, so always check there first when a cutoff looks wrong. To unlock the calendar service's admin console after a restart, enter the recovery passphrase below.

vault phrase of bagap-bahaf = silion-pelox-sorox-casdor-quenwyn-fraax-eliox-praael-kelion-quenvan-kasox-rusael-norius-belvan

## Runbook: Sensor drift — Verdanthaus greenhouse controller

If humidity or temperature readings from a Verdanthaus bay diverge more than 3% from the reference probe for over 15 minutes, the controller flags drift and holds actuators at last-known-good positions. First, confirm the reference probe itself is healthy via the calibration panel. If the probe checks out, trigger a soft recalibration; do not hard-reset during daylight hours, as vents will slam shut. Recalibration reads its tolerances and hold timings from the following values.

config for tagep-yajef:
ulawyn:
  log_level: error
  metrics_host: metrics.ulawyn.lumiclabs.internal
  pin: 0564
  pool_size: 32

Ticket: Staging env misconfigured for Siftgate bloom filter

The bloom layer in front of the Pellet KV store is rejecting all lookups in staging because the env file was copied from the dev template without credentials. False-positive tuning values are fine; only the auth line is missing. To unblock the weekly demo, the Pellet admission secret must be set on the following line.

env line for yaguf-fajop: LEDGER_TOKEN13=fb08984397349